Wings to Dreams by artist Dixie Friend Gay celebrates the native fauna of Erie, Colorado through an unexpected medium: polished stainless steel. To bridge humanity’s present with nature’s past, Gay envisioned natural forms crafted from one of the most resilient materials in the built environment. JunoWorks translated her concept into a detailed fabrication model using Rhino 3D, breaking down the design into components suitable for production. CRAFT was brought in to evaluate the structural performance of the delicate marque elements.
Preliminary design development focused on defining a fabrication strategy and determining detailing requirements for each marque component. This process relied on hand calculations, while the central structural pipe was specified for global demands. Special consideration was needed for the delicate sculptural expressions; although solid and perforated plate profiles were chosen for their visual lightness and cost-efficiency, they still needed to be stiff enough to withstand high prairie winds without rattling. With such complicated forms, traditional structural modeling techniques fell short of the task.
The organic forms of the marque fauna also required an organic modeling process. Without parametric geometry development and a distinct lack of rectilinear geometry, creating 2D lines and surfaces with properly aligned nodes suitable for finite element analysis would require an extraordinary amount of model manipulation. Using Rhino with Grasshopper plugins, the sculptural elements were shrink wrapped and represented as a single closed-mesh suitable for FE analysis.
